Supported Applications
The Omega LCM203 Series comprises high-accuracy, miniature, low-profile industrial load cells designed for tension and compression measurement. These dual stud mount style sensors feature a hermetically sealed stainless steel construction suitable for most industrial weighing applications. The series is engineered for use in test stands and difficult locations where space constraints require a compact package.
Operating Conditions & Performance
The LCM203 Series operates within an ambient temperature range of -46 to 107°C (-50 to 225°F), with thermal compensation provided for the 16 to 71°C (60 to 160°F) span. The sensors are rated IP65 and feature a deflection between 0.025 to 0.075 mm (0.001 to 0.003"). Performance specifications include linearity of ±0.15% FSO, hysteresis of ±0.1% FSO, and repeatability of ±0.05% FSO. The series supports a measurement range from 100 N to 50,000 N (22 lb to 11,241 lb) across various capacities.
Electrical performance is defined by an excitation voltage of 10 Vdc with a maximum of 15 Vdc. The output signal is specified as 2 mV/V ±1.0%. Input resistance is 350 Ω minimum, and output resistance is 350 ±10 Ω. Overload ratings are defined as Safe Overload at 150% of capacity and Ultimate Overload at 300% of capacity.
Configuration Options
The series offers configurable options for mounting, electrical connection, and accessories to accommodate specific installation requirements. Key capabilities include:
- Housing & Mounting: Dual Stud Mount Style with a 51 mm (2") diameter body.
- Thread Configurations: Metric models feature M12 x 1.75 threads on both ends, while standard inch models utilize ½-20 UNF threads.
- Cable & Connector Options: Standard units include a 3 m (10') 4-conductor shielded PVC cable. The LC213/LCM213 variants support the PT06F10-6S mating connector or CA-4PC24-2-015 cable assembly with twist-lock connector.
- Accessories: Rod ends are available as REC-012F for LC203/LC213 series and MREC-M12F for LCM203/LCM213 series load cells.
Key Product Differences
The product line distinguishes between standard inch models (LC203) and metric models (LCM203), as well as cable-equipped versions versus connector-ready variants. The LC213/LCM213 series designates units configured for the PT06F10-6S mating connector rather than a fixed cable.
Thread dimensions vary by model family: A threads measure 19 mm (0.75") in length, while B threads are 17 mm (0.69"). The series provides capacities ranging from 25 lb to 10,000 lb for inch models and 100 N to 50,000 N for metric models. All units include a 5-point calibration in tension at 0%, 50%, 100%, 50%, and 0% of capacity.
